Hycroft Mining Holding Corporation is a gold and silver exploration and development company that owns the Hycroft Mine in the mining region of Northern Nevada. Hycroft Mine, a gold and silver operation, is located 54 miles northwest of Winnemucca, spanning Humboldt and Pershing counties in Nevada. It focuses on exploration drilling and data analyses, completing technical studies, conducting trade-off studies and alternative analyses for determining the optimal process flow sheet for processing sulfide ores and recovering gold and silver. The Hycroft Mine is an operating segment and includes the mine site, exploration, and development activities. The property consists of 25 patented claims covering approximately 1,855 acres and 3,249 unpatented lode and placer claims spanning roughly 62,298 acres, totaling approximately 64,000 acres. It contains measured and indicated mineral resources which include approximately 16.4 million ounces of gold and 562.6 million ounces of silver.
